Van Hall Larenstein offers students from NFP countries a ‘VHL Excellent Student Scholarship’ of 3500 euro by enrolment for the next study year 2011-2012 in a bachelor degree programme (except for IBMS). The scholarship will apply for students who enrol for the first time in a bachelor programme of Van Hall Larenstein, and start in August 2011.
Conditions to get a waiver:
- Students who have been admitted in a bachelor programme or a final phase programme, study year 2011-2012 and enrolled before the 1st of June 2011.
- Students from an NFP country
- The reduction is on the tuition fee only. For visa, insurance and administration there will be extra costs. Click here for an overview of the other costs.
- Students who start in September 2011 at Van Hall Larenstein for the first time; a first enrolment.
- You have to pay the whole tuition fee first. Once you have arrived in the Netherlands and own a Dutch bank account, you can receive the waiver of 3500 euro.

NFP countries
To be eligible for an NFP fellowship, you must beb a national of and working and living in one of the following 60 countries:
Afghanistan Eritrea Nicaragua Albania Ethiopia Nigeria Armenia Georgia Pakistan Autonomous Palestinian Territories Ghana Peru Bangladesh Guatemala Philippines Benin Guinea-Bissau Rwanda Bhutan Honduras Senegal Bolivia India South Africa Bosnia-Herzegovina Indonesia Sri Lanka Brazil Iran Sudan Burkina Faso Ivory Coast Suriname Burundi Jordan Tanzania Cambodia Kenya Thailand Cape Verde Kosovo Uganda Colombia Macedonia Vietnam Costa Rica Mali Yemen Cuba Moldova Zambia DR Congo Mongolia Zimbabwe Ecuador Mozambique Egypt Namibia El Salvador Nepal
